Constellations

Every character in Teyvat has a unique density that will require them to achieve their maximum potential one day. The universe has decided that the standard metric of a vision wielder's growth can be divided up into 7 states. Each represents one of the 7 stars in the sky that form their "constellation," which is the astral projection of their future onto the fabric of reality that makes up the Tevat nighttime sky.

These seven states are colloquially referred to at "C0- C6" where C0 means "constellation 0" and is a fresh character who hasn't ascended past the beginning stages of their story. In contrast, a "C6" character has drawn out every inch of their talent and is essentially ready for ultimate high-level combat if they know the right skills. A c6 character's story is far from over when they achieve this state, however, they usually will embody a more mentorship role or team "ace" position. 

When unlocking a new level of one's constellation, you may only add one new ability of that constellation's corresponding level type or a lower-level one that is not custom. 

Some constellations may be taken multiple times and progressively improve upon retakes.

C1: Choose from the C1 Selection.

C2: Choose from the C2 Selection or below.

C3: A Custom skill modification: The C3 constellation marks the halfway point for your character. Take the most relied-upon elemental skill that they have and propose an improvement or change that your character would make to it. The GM will create a new version of this skill unique to the character that includes the flavor improvement alongside a minor buff. 

C4: 4th constellation skills are very powerful feats that can drastically change the mechanics of your character and the flow of the battle. Choose from the C4 Selection or Below.

C5: Choose a feat from the C5 selection or below.

C6: Ultimate Skill: A C6 skill is the most impressive category of skill that lands somewhere between unfair and reality-bending.Teyvat has its own laws, and one of them is that density is absolute. Since each skill is unique to each character, it has to be discussed with the GM in order to create them but to give a metric of what is possible: Multiple-attacks, the ability to revive multiple downed team members, complete team combat heals, mass elemental infusions, mass team attack buffs, separate weapon states, and more. A c6 skill defines the peak refinement of a character's ability set, riding the gap between satisfying narrative and strong mechanics. Alternatively, chose a feat from the C5 selection or below.
